In This Role, Your Responsibilities Will Be:
  • Support talent acquisition activities by searching candidate resumes using defined criteria and sourcing tools.
  • Coordinate and schedule interviews with candidates and hiring teams.
  • Manage interview logistics, including arranging meeting rooms, preparing interview materials, and coordinating communications.
  • Provide timely candidate communication, including interview confirmations, reminders, and follow-up correspondence.
  • Assist with new hire onboarding preparation by coordinating documentation, checklists, and administrative requirements.
  • Create, maintain, and update inventory records for HR documents, equipment, and office supplies.
  • Support HR office relocation activities by organizing, labeling, packing, unpacking, and arranging HR materials and records.
  • Conduct post-relocation reviews to help ensure HR workspaces, documents, and resources are organized and accessible.
  • Provide general administrative and clerical support to the HR team as needed.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ement efforts by identifying opportunities to enhance efficiency, organization, and team collaboration.

For This Role, You Will Need:
  • Current undergraduate or graduate student pursuing a deg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, Psychology, or a related field.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, particularly Excel and PowerPoint.
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ities.
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a team-oriented environment.
  • Attention to detail and commitment to maintaining accurate records and documentation.
  • Ability to handle confidential information with professionalism and integrity.
  • Availability to commit to the internship for a minimum of three months.
Preferred Qualifications That Set You Apart:
  • Previous internship, campus organization, project, or administrative experience in HR, recruiting, or business operations.
  • Familiarity with recruitment processes, applicant tracking systems, or HR systems.
  • Experience coordinating events, schedules, or projects.
  • Demonstrated interest in talent acquisition, employee experience, or human resources operations.
  • Ability to adapt quickly to changing priorities and work independently when needed.

ABOUT EMERSON 

Emerson is a global leader in automation technology and software. Through our deep domain expertise and legacy of flawless execution, Emerson helps customers in critical industries like life sciences, energy, power and renewables, chemical and advanced factory automation operate more sustainably while improving productivity, energy security and reliability.

With global operations and a comprehensive portfolio of software and technology, we are helping companies implement digital transformation to measurably improve their operations, conserve valuable resources and enhance their safety.
